Conversion Formula

The formula for converting kilopascals to atmospheres is: atm = kPa ÷ 101.325. This works because 1 atm equals 101.325 kPa, a standard pressure measurement. By dividing the pressure in kPa by 101.325, you get how many atmospheres that pressure represents.

For example, if you have 50 kPa, the calculation is 50 ÷ 101.325 = approximately 0.4937 atm, meaning the pressure is less than one atmosphere, scaled proportionally.

Conversion Definitions

kpa

Kilopascal (kPa) is a pressure unit equal to 1,000 pascals, used in measuring force per unit area in scientific and engineering contexts, especially for atmospheric and fluid pressure. It helps quantify pressure differences in various systems and environments.

atm

Atmosphere (atm) is a pressure unit defined as the standard pressure at sea level, exactly 101.325 kilopascals. It is used in physics and chemistry to compare pressures, particularly in gas laws and environmental measurements, providing a common reference point.
